The Beauty And Functionality Of A Roof Lantern

A roof lantern is a beautiful and functional architectural feature that has been used for centuries to bring natural light into a space It is essentially a roof window or skylight that is built into the roof of a building to allow sunlight to enter the interior Roof lanterns are commonly seen in traditional and modern architectural designs and can enhance the aesthetic appeal of a building while also providing practical benefits.

The history of roof lanterns can be traced back to ancient times when they were used in buildings such as temples and palaces to create a sense of grandeur and beauty In Western architecture, roof lanterns became more popular during the Georgian and Victorian eras, where they were used in grand homes and public buildings to bring light into large rooms and decorative features.

One of the key benefits of a roof lantern is the amount of natural light it allows into a space By having a roof lantern, you can significantly reduce the need for artificial lighting during the day, which can help lower energy costs and create a more sustainable living environment The natural light that enters through a roof lantern can also help improve the mood and productivity of the occupants by creating a brighter and more uplifting atmosphere.

In terms of functionality, a roof lantern can also provide ventilation and improve air circulation in a building Many roof lanterns are designed to be opened and closed, allowing fresh air to enter a space and hot air to escape This can help regulate the temperature inside a building and create a more comfortable living environment for the occupants In addition, by providing natural light and ventilation, a roof lantern can help reduce the risk of mold and mildew growth inside a building, which can be harmful to the health of the occupants.
